…About 800,000 Turks left Greece and about 2 million Greeks returned, but the national economy deteriorated significantly due to the defeat and the need to protect the returnees, and the government was barely supported by aid from the League of Nations and the United States (until 1925). Prior to this, Venizelos was ousted in the November 1920 election, and Constantine, who was restored to the throne, was also driven out, and Georgios II (reigned 1922-24, 1935-47) ascended to the throne, but the republicans won the general election in 1924 and the monarchy was abolished. The first president was former Minister of the Navy Koundouriotis, but the political struggle between the royalists and republicans continued and coups were repeated. …
